It's the plastic package that covers the bottle opening completely. The
airtight seal is made by the threads of the screw ring that contains the
nipple. The air that passes thru the nipple hole meets only with the top
surface of the plastic package. It's like covering the bottle with plastic
wrap & screwing down the cap to assure that air doesn't pass thru the screw
threads.
